Sunday, September 11, 2011

10 years ago today....

It's hard to believe 10 years ago today was 09.11.01... I remember everything I did on that day. I was woken up by a phone call from my mom telling me to turn on the TV and that there had been a terrorist attack. I remember watching the 2nd plane fly into the other world trade center building and I remember asking myself is this real?

I graduated from high school 3 month before and was in college. I was talking to my best friend at the time, Adrianna, and I remember the first building falling down.... It then hit me it was for real when I saw people running from the huge cloud of dust and debris.

It was a Tuesday and I only had one college class that day, English. I was scared to go to school, but I did. I remember walking into the building and down the stairs to where my class was. There was a group of people huddled around the TV and there was my teacher telling all of us to go home.

I go home and I was also scared to go to work that day, but I went... I worked at Wendy's and we hardly had any business. We spent most of the time in the back of the store watching the TV my manager brought in. There was a few points in the day we thought we heard plane flying by and I remember everyone being worried if something was going to happen in the area I lived in, since we lived about 2 hours from Shanksville.

I have goosebumps right now, as I am recalling this day.

Two years ago Matt and I stopped by the flight 93 memorial on our way home from Baltimore over the 4th of July weekend.

It was a surreal place to be. I remember how quiet it was... you could hear a pin drop.

Atria's Restaurant & Tavern

Today... well yesterday since it's 1:30am... After looking for a wedding dress my mom and I picked up Matt and we went to Atria's Restaurant & Tavern for dinner. They are celebrating Oktoberfest, which we all ended up order from the Oktoberfest menu.

We all started with a soup. My mom got the Sherry Crab Bisque and Matt and I got the Allgäuer Käsesuppe soup. It is a creamy Bavarian cheese soup with whipped cream and croutons. All of our soups were really good.

For our entrees my mom ordered the Wiener Zwiebel Schnitzel, tender hand breaded veal medallions with crisp fried onions served over traditional German potato cakes.She said her veal was very good and tender.

Matt ordered the Famous Jägermeister platte, grilled bockwurst and knockwurst with roasted pork loin, kraut spätzle, hot German potato salad and a shot of Jägermeister. He wasn't too thrilled with the bockwurst and knockwurst, he said it tasted like hot dogs, but really liked the kraut spätzle. I did try a piece of his knockwurst and the knockwurst we had a Max's Allegheny Tavern was better.

For my entree I ordered Paprika Händel, hand breaded, fried chicken breast with fresh peppers in a creamy paprika sauce served over käse spätzle. Which I though was pretty good.

All of our portions were huge and we ended up with doggy bags, since we saved room for dessert...
